What is the AYBC?

Founded in 1956, the Anchor Yale Bible Commentary series was initially developed to bring together leading scholars in the field of biblical studies. Over the decades, it has evolved to incorporate the latest research and methodological advancements, solidifying its reputation as a critical resource.

The AYBC is a comprehensive, book-by-book analysis of the Bible, including the Hebrew Bible, New Testament, and apocrypha. It aims to provide thorough exegesis and exact translations, drawing on the expertise of renowned scholars from various religious backgrounds, including eminent scholars such as E. A. SpeiserWilliam H. C. ProppJacob Milgrom, and Baruch A. Levine.

Organized into individual volumes dedicated to each book of the Bible, the AYBC adopts a meticulous approach. Each volume includes comprehensive introductions, detailed exegesis, and extensive bibliographies, facilitating in-depth study.

Due to rights issues, the commentary on Matthew is not included in this collection and is no longer available for purchase.

Known for its scholarly rigor, the AYBC employs unique methodologies such as linguistic analysis, historical-critical methods, and comparative studies. This ensures a multifaceted understanding of biblical texts.

The Anchor Yale Bible Series, previously the Anchor Bible Series, is a renowned publishing program that for more than 50 years has produced books devoted to the latest scholarship on the Bible and biblical topics. Yale University Press, having acquired this prestigious series in 2007, is now proud to offer all previously published Anchor Bible titles as well as new books—more than 115 titles in all. Many more volumes are in progress as the AYB Editorial Board, under the direction of General Editor John J. Collins, vigorously pursues the goal of bringing to a wide audience the most important new ideas, the latest research findings, and the clearest possible analysis of the Bible. Widely recognized as the flagship of American biblical scholarship, the Anchor Yale Bible Series is comprised of:

  • Anchor Yale Bible Commentary (AYBC), a book-by-book translation and exegesis of the Hebrew Bible, the New Testament, and the Apocrypha
  • Anchor Yale Bible Dictionary (AYBD), a state-of-the-art dictionary in six volumes with more than 6,000 entries from 800 international scholars
  • The Anchor Yale Bible Reference Library, containing more than 40 volumes by foremost scholars from a variety of religious backgrounds who focus on broad biblical themes
